Fox, Wednesdays, 9 p.m.
Lee Daniels has called his hip-hop soap opera “the black Dynasty” and that’s all I needed to want to record it, but having Terrence Howard as a music mogul, Taraji P. Henson as his criminal wife and Courtney Love wandering around being insane has made me desperate to watch. The overacting is a given, but Daniels and writer Danny Strong are responsible for the most ridiculous campfest known as The Butler, so Empire could be more fun than it has a right being. Apparently, the music, written and produced by Timbaland, is legitimately good, so that’s another reason.
